But what people fail to realise is how important support actually is for a small business.
One like pushes a post further.
One comment boosts engagement.
One share could bring in a paying customer.
One recommendation could literally help someone pay their bills that month.
Support costs absolutely nothing, but to a small business owner it can mean everything.
Behind every order, enquiry, post and late-night idea is a real person trying to make something of themselves. No huge team. No celebrity status. No millions of followers. Just passion, pressure, hard work and hope that people will care enough to support it.
And the funny thing is… strangers are often the loudest supporters. The people who owe you nothing are sometimes the ones cheering you on the most.
Never underestimate how far a little support can go for a small business. It matters more than people think.
